Kiss It Better First Aid would like to wish you all a lovely Easter 🐰

With many children running around trying to find Easter Eggs make sure you have stocked up your first aid kit if someone takes a tumble. βž•

Please take extra care with young children eating small chocolate eggs. Mini eggs are the same size as a young child's airway and can pose a choking risk for children under the age of 4. Slicing them down the middle lengthways can help by turning them into an uneven shape.🍫
